Transaction 41677fc03e2340352e4ab71465ec238bb08ca8694cda7472eaedd6d2ce15c1b9

4 Input
2 Outputs
  • 41677fc03e2340352e4ab71465ec238bb08ca8694cda7472eaedd6d2ce15c1b9:0
  • value  1095273
    address  16y9dgTNYjApDuTiLJ5eUx7wWpf4tGcxw8
  • 41677fc03e2340352e4ab71465ec238bb08ca8694cda7472eaedd6d2ce15c1b9:1
  • value  21815247
    address  3GiKBdzGb2bDyCBAFTSWnSafmmf84HPLmb